US Secretary of State visits Moldova
1 minute read

YEREVAN, MAY 29, ARMENPRESS. US Secretary of State Antony Blinken arrived in the Moldovan capital of Chişinau on Wednesday before traveling to Prague to attend a NATO foreign ministers meeting.
The trip comes just two weeks after Blinken made an unannounced trip to Ukraine to reassure Kyiv of Washington's support, the AP reports.
In Chisinau, Blinken will meet Moldova's President Maia Sandu and other senior officials.
According to Reuters, Jim O'Brien, the top U.S. diplomat for Europe at the State Department, told reporters on Friday that the United States would likely announce a "robust package" of support for Moldova's energy independence, without elaborating.
In the evening, Blinken will go to Prague for an informal meeting of NATO ministers of foreign affairs on May 30.
